Nicotinamide Mononucleotide (NMN), a key precursor to Nicotinamide Adenine Dinucleotide (NAD+), is gaining significant attention for its potential to support these vital bodily functions. NMN plays an instrumental role in cellular energy metabolism, acting as the raw material from which our cells synthesize NAD+.

NAD+ is a coenzyme that is indispensable for hundreds of cellular processes, including the conversion of food into energy. As we age, our natural NAD+ levels tend to decrease, which can manifest as reduced energy, increased fatigue, and slower metabolic rates. NMN supplementation offers a promising avenue to counteract this decline by providing the necessary building blocks for NAD+ synthesis.
